Following last year’s sell-out concert, ROKiT Choir returns with ROKiT From the Musicals, bringing another unforgettable evening to The Exchange. Bigger and better than ever, this year’s show promises all the energy, heart, and entertainment that made the last performance such a huge success.


Featuring over 100 singers from one of the area’s fastest-growing independent choirs, the performance will also proudly include the brand new Sturminster Newton ROKiT Choir group—making this a truly special local celebration of music and community.


Audiences can look forward to a fantastic selection of songs from some of the most loved musicals around. From the powerful drama of Les Miserable to the feel-good anthems of We Will Rock You, alongside hits from Rock of Ages, Ghost and more, there’s something for everyone to enjoy.


ROKiT are known for their vibrant performances, big sound, and welcoming atmosphere, making this the perfect night out whether you’re a musical theatre enthusiast or simply after some top-quality live entertainment.


Adding an extra splash of fun, the evening will also feature special guests Opera-lele—a unique comedy duo combining opera, ukulele, and a brilliantly British sense of humour. Expect laughs, surprises, and something a little bit different.

H is for Hawk

H is for Hawk follows Helen who, after the sudden death of her father loses herself in the memories of their time birding and exploring the natural world together and turns the ancient art of falconry-rooted in European tradition-training a wild goshawk named Mabel to navigate her profound loss. But as she teaches Mabel to hunt and fly free, Helen discovers how deeply she has neglected her own emotions and life. What begins as an act of endurance transforms into an intimate journey of resilience and healing.


Starring Claire Foy, Brendan Gleeson and Lindsay Duncan
